Problems solved by technology

[0004] The three-dimensional molding device using RP technology is manual when spreading powder, printing and taking out the molded product, and the dust raised will often cause pollution to the working environment, and it is easy to contaminate the entire operating machine of the three-dimensional molding device , in order to maintain the normal operation, the conventional technology needs to manually carry out the work of vacuuming and cleaning after a certain stage of operation
In this way, in the cleaning process of conventional RP technology, it is easy to accidentally damage the molded product and the components of the three-dimensional molding device due to manual operation; and, high-frequency cleaning will also cause waste of manpower and time, which relatively improves the overall Production cost, and if the frequency of cleaning is reduced, there is a risk of dust pollution and it is difficult to keep the working space clean

Abstract

The invention relates to a residual powder recovery constructing tank system of a stereo-prototyping mechanism. The system comprises: a constructing tank having a constructing platform, a first opening and a second opening, wherein the constructing platform is used for bearing construct powder, and a stereo-prototyping object is formed on the constructing platform through the constructing powder; a positive pressure adjusting device arranged at the first opening of the constructing tank and used for providing a positive pressure to the inside of the constructing tank; a negative pressure adjusting device arranged at the second opening of the constructing tank and used for providing a negative pressure to the inside of the constructing tank; and a guide plat arranged on the constructing platform. Airflow is generated in the constructing tank through the positive pressure adjusting device, and goes through a plurality of channels of the guide plate to form spiral airflow in order to drive residual powder, so the residual powder is guided out of the constructing tank through the negative pressure adjusting device to complete residual powder recovery.

Background technique [0002] Rapid Prototyping (RP technology for short) is a technology derived from the concept of building a pyramid layer by layer, which can quickly and cost-effectively shape the designer's idea in a short time and present it to the public. Its main feature is the quickness of forming, which can automatically and quickly convert any complex shape design into a 3D solid model without any tools, molds and jigs, which greatly shortens the development cycle of new products And reduce the cost of research and development, and can ensure the time to market of new products and the success rate of new product development.
